Package: boot-floppies
Version: N/A
Severity: important


got the latest testing disks-i386 pakcage to intall sid / testing over the internet and the network was set up and kernel packages installed (from local hard drive).

When trying to install the base system, it would ask for the location to download from, and then show an error saying debootstrap exited abnormally and come back to the main menu. There was not more information on the tty3.

Attempted to run debootstrap manually, copying the commandline from tty3, failed mentioning  along the lines about architecture not detected and other times about 3:  invalid file descriptor.

I tried export ARCH=i386 and tried just debootstrap sid /target which seemed to start something. Pressed Ctrl-C because the command line was different. went back to tty and tried install base system again. This time, it seemed to work. It got all the packages from the us site (not the uk site, my guess possibly due to slow mirroring or something - dont know) until all wingtail was downloaded and then in crashed out again with same error. Nothing more informative in tty3 again.

Hope this helps. I have reverted to some old cd's to install the distribution. Could try to reproduce if important.

Changes: 
 boot-floppies (3.0.9) unstable; urgency=low
 .
   * Falk Hueffner
     - New library reducing script mklibs.py, using different algorithm
       that is likelier not to add unneeded symbols. Activated by default
       for Alpha, since mklibs.sh doesn't make them small enough;
       we may move all arches to this in next release
     - Don't copy sys_map and kernel config to rescue floppy on Alpha since
       aboot doesn't fit otherwise.
   * David Kimdon
     - no free adverstising for commercial companies
       closes: #105492
     - Update Danish dbootstrap messages thanks to
       Claus Hindsgaul <claus_h@image.dk>
   * Richard Hirst
     - fix md5sum.txt contents for hppa
     - doc updates for ia64 and hppa
     - move elilo in to /usr/sbin
     - call ia64 kernel linux rather than vmlinux to match other archs
     - ia64 and hppa now use 2.4.7 kernel
   * John H. Robinson, IV
     - Fixed the serial console not 9600 problem
     - Added ReiserFS support
   * Martin Schulze
     - fix nfsroot detection problem for mips
   * Matt Kraai
     - check host name for RFC 1123 compliance
   * Phil Blundell
     - ARM is now using kernel 2.4.5
   * Christian T. Steigies
     - m68k: add more Mac (not map...) keymaps to keymaps.gz.
       I waited one week for a Mac user to test it. Nobody dared...
   * Henning Heinold
     - mips fixing libfdisk for mips (patch from Guido Guenther)
     - mips adding dvhtool (patch from Guido Guenther)
   * Stefan Gybas
     - Initial S/390 support (not working yet)
   * Adam Di Carlo:
     - help the library reduction be better, we hope, by reducing libnewt
       first, then libslang
     - build-depend on aboot for alpha
       closes: #107622
     - build-depend on syslinux for i386
       closes: #107517
     - sparc/sun4u uses kernel-image-2.4.7-sun4u (not 2.4.4)
     - root filesystem: provide /var/dhcp, hopefully this will help when
       dhclient fails
       closes: #107381
   * Guido Guenther
     - dbootstrap: changes for dvhtool support and other MIPS porting
       issues; ip22 should boot now
     - mips now buildable (we hope!)
   * Karsten Merker
     - more mips and mipsel support
   * new busybox/wget fixes the segfault problems installing base
     closes: #107532, #107154
   * new ash should fix some problems configuring modules
     closes: #106693, #107377
